About Anthony Phillips

Anthony Phillips is a scholar working on Mathematical Physics, Geometry and Topology, Religious studies, Nuclear and High Energy Physics and Sociology and Political Science, having authored 48 papers that have together received 469 indexed citations. Recurring topics across this work include Biblical Studies and Interpretation (9 papers), Quantum Chromodynamics and Particle Interactions (6 papers), Archaeology and Historical Studies (5 papers), Black Holes and Theoretical Physics (5 papers), Drilling and Well Engineering (5 papers), Hydraulic Fracturing and Reservoir Analysis (5 papers), Geometric and Algebraic Topology (5 papers) and Tunneling and Rock Mechanics (4 papers). The work is most often cited by research in Mathematical Physics (127 citations), Geometry and Topology (120 citations), Nuclear and High Energy Physics (136 citations), Religious studies (34 citations) and Algebra and Number Theory (29 citations). Anthony Phillips has collaborated with scholars based in United States and United Kingdom. Frequent co-authors include David A. Stone, H. J. Bernstein, Dennis Sullivan, Moshe Greenberg, Moira Chas, Colin Daniels, Liangbo Liang, Lisa R. Goldberg, John Milnor and Bobby G. Sumpter. Their work appears in journals such as Vetus Testamentum, Journal for the Study of the Old Testament, Theology, Communications in Mathematical Physics and Journal of Jewish Studies.
